    Due to the small amount of games, I'm guessing either Steam or a PC CD disc (like the Mega Drive Collection Volumes in Europe) if it is true.

    Apart from Baku Baku Animal, Ristar and Sonic Drift 2, most of these seem to be Master System games (I know Baku Baku did get a Brazilian Master System release but I doubt that it would be used). Sonic (1?), Sonic Chaos, Sonic Spinball, Dragon Crystal, Columns, Putt and Putter, Robotnik's Mean Bean Machine and Ecco: Tides of Time could be either console.

    Overall a selection of good and decent games with a few clunkers. I would how Assault City would be handled considering that it is a light gun game unless it uses the controller version.
